Tree crown shaping services involve the strategic pruning and trimming of a tree’s uppermost branches to improve its overall form and health. This process typically includes removing dead, diseased, or overcrowded branches to promote better airflow and light penetration within the canopy. The goal is to create a balanced, aesthetically pleasing shape while reducing the risk of branch failure or damage caused by storm winds. Tree crown shaping can also help manage the size and growth pattern of a tree, preventing it from encroaching on nearby structures, power lines, or other landscape features.

This service addresses several common problems associated with overgrown or poorly maintained trees. Overgrown crowns can lead to increased risk of falling branches, which pose safety hazards to people and property. Additionally, dense or uneven canopies can hinder sunlight reaching the ground, affecting lawn health and surrounding plants. Tree crown shaping can also improve the overall appearance of a property by maintaining a neat and controlled tree profile, which enhances curb appeal and landscaping aesthetics. Proper crown management can contribute to the longevity and vitality of the tree by removing problematic limbs before they cause damage.

Basic Crown Shaping - Typically costs between $150 and $400 for small to medium trees. This service includes pruning to improve shape and remove dead or crossing branches. Prices vary based on tree size and complexity.

Detailed Crown Shaping - Usually ranges from $400 to $1,200 for larger or more intricate work. It involves precise trimming to enhance the tree’s aesthetic and structural health. The cost depends on the tree’s height and density.

Crown Thinning - Expect to pay approximately $200 to $600 for thinning services on mature trees. This process reduces weight and wind resistance, requiring careful removal of selected branches. Costs are influenced by tree size and canopy density.

Complete Crown Reshaping - Generally falls within $500 to $2,000, especially for extensive overhauls of large trees. It involves comprehensive pruning to restore balance and shape. The price varies based on the scope of work and tree accessibility.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

Tree Crown Shaping services involve pruning and trimming to improve the shape and structure of tree crowns, enhancing their appearance and health. Local professionals can tailor crown shaping to suit specific landscape goals and tree species.

Tree Crown Thinning focuses on selectively removing branches to reduce density, allowing more light and air to reach the interior of the tree. Experienced service providers can perform thinning to promote healthier growth and stability.

Tree Crown Reduction involves carefully trimming the upper parts of a tree to decrease its height or spread, which can help prevent interference with structures or power lines. Local arborists can execute reduction projects safely and effectively.

Structural Tree Pruning aims to remove weak or crossing branches to improve the overall framework of the tree, reducing the risk of damage during storms. Skilled contractors can assess and perform structural pruning for safety and longevity.

Formative Crown Shaping services are used on young trees to develop a strong, healthy structure early on. Local experts can shape young trees to ensure proper growth patterns over time.

Selective Crown Cleaning involves removing dead, diseased, or hazardous branches to improve the tree’s overall health and appearance. Service providers can evaluate and carry out cleaning to maintain tree vitality.
